Bryn Forbes Assigned By Spurs To D-League

Dec 27, 2016 8:14 PM

The San Antonio Spurs have assigned guard Bryn Forbes to the Austin Spurs of the NBA Development League.

In five appearances with Austin, Forbes is averaging 20.8 points, 3.2 rebounds and 1.0 assists in 34.5 minutes, shooting .531 (34-64) from the field and .593 (16-27) from beyond the arc.

The first-year guard has appeared in 13 games for San Antonio this season.

Spurs Waive Nico Laprovittola

Dec 27, 2016 8:01 PM

The San Antonio Spurs have waived Nico Laprovittola.

Laprovittola, who was in his first season with the Spurs, was signed as a free agent on Sept. 26, 2016. He saw action in 18 games for the Spurs, averaging 3.3 points and 1.6 assists in 9.7 minutes.

Laprovittola played for Lietuvos Rytas last season.

Kawhi Leonard Still Figuring Out Nuances Of Being Go-To Scorer

Dec 7, 2016 11:10 AM

Kawhi Leonard has scored 30 or more points on six different occasions so far this season compared to just four 30-point games over the first five seasons of his career.

"By this point in his career, he's a confident player," Gregg Popovich said. "He knows he has a green light. We call his number now and then, but he does a lot of this stuff on his own, and he's getting pretty good at pick-and-roll. So he just advances his game every year a little bit in some different fashion, and tonight he did the same thing: pulled up, knocked down a couple 3s. He just has confidence that they're going to go. Special, special young man."

"We're gonna keep going to him, and he knows that, too," Danny Green said. "I guess at the beginning of the game, he kinds of finds a rhythm or kind of finds out what kind of night it's gonna be to adjust to what he needs to do, how the defense is playing. He's done a good job of that, pacing himself, not forcing it, kind of getting others involved at the same time, kind of keeping the defense off balance, keeping them honest; not just looking to score every time, but facilitating as well."

Despite the green light and big role within the San Antonio Spurs' offense, Leonard is still navigating the freedom.

"I'm still trying to get my teammates involved more," Leonard said. "Having a green light doesn't mean you just shoot every possession. You just get the defense drawn to you, two guys, and pass it to the open man. I'm just learning through the double-teams, through people forcing me a certain way and help being there. Just still a process for me."

Tony Parker Could Miss Extended Time With Knee Injury

Dec 6, 2016 2:48 PM

Tony Parker has suffered a knee injury and could be out an extended period of time.

Parker had started on Monday after missing the previous two games with a thigh contusion.

Parker is averaging 9.7 points and 4.3 assists in his 16th season.

Spurs, Warriors Tried To Trade Up In 2011 For Jonas Valanciunas

Dec 6, 2016 11:29 AM

The Golden State Warriors and San Antonio Spurs walked away from the 2011 NBA Draft with Klay Thompson and Kawhi Leonard, but both teams were looking to trade into the top-5 to select Jonas Valanciunas.

Valanciunas fell to the Toronto Raptors at No. 5 as he wasn't planning on coming over to the NBA for one more season.

Bob Myers suspected the Spurs' Plan B in trading up ahead of the Warriors at No. 11 was to select Thompson, the player they were targeting with their lottery pick.

The Milwaukee Bucks also liked Thompson and they were picking 10th, but they moved out of the spot following a trade with the Sacramento Kings, who wanted Jimmer Fredette.
